      <description>&lt;P&gt;I would think that what ShadowSports said is true. You can take them to a big box store like BestBuy, Staples, etc, But be aware that the film in the cartridge has your pictures on them. I have only gone through the sample cartridge so far, but I plan to pull out the film from the cartridges as I finish each. No strangers need pictures of my granddaughter.&lt;BR /&gt;It's easy enough to pull out the film without having to break the cartridge.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
